Nov 4, 2025 Geoff Kabaservice, Vice President for Political Studies at the Niskanen Center, dives into the intriguing rise of Zohran Mamdani, a young, Muslim, Democratic socialist and a surprising contender for New York City mayor. They discuss Mamdani's bold policies like rent reforms, universal childcare, and public housing. Kabaservice explores the challenges Mamdani faces in implementing his agenda and critiques from opponents like Andrew Cuomo. Finally, they consider how Mamdani's success could reshape the Democratic landscape and engage younger voters.

Rapid Rise From Obscurity
- Zohran Mamdani rose quickly from political obscurity to become a frontrunner for New York mayor.
- He had little prior elective experience before winning his Assembly seat in 2021 and then the Democratic nomination.
What 'Democratic Socialist' Means Here
- Mamdani is a member of the Democratic Socialists of America and sits on the party's far left.
- Geoff Kabaservice contrasts democratic socialism with social democracy and warns democratic socialism aims to end capitalism.
Ambitious Affordability Platform
- Mamdani's platform targets affordability: rent measures, free buses, universal childcare and large public housing builds.
- He proposes funding via higher corporate tax and raising income tax on those making over $1 million.
